6th Grade Solving Itinerary Problems Using Comparison: Problem 2
3 years ago
6
Problem: Two classes are going on a field trip. The school only has one bus that's big enough to hold one class, so as the bus takes one class the other one has to walk. And then, the bus turns around to pick the walking class up. The two classes walk 4 kilometers per hour. When the bus is carrying a class, its speed is 40 kilometers per hour. When the bus is not carrying a class, its speed is 50 kilometers per hour. If the two classes wants to be at their destination in the shortest time possible, then what fraction of the total distance does the first class walk?
Key: 1) Create a sketch; 2) Use speed ratios
